Gas Mass Flow Sensor Circuit – Shorted High
|
Overview
| CODE | REASON | EFFECT |
| Fault Code: 453 PID: P183 SPN: 183 FMI: 3 LAMP: Amber SRT: |
Gas Mass Flow Sensor Circuit – Shorted High. High voltage detected on the sensor signal pin at the ECM. |
Possible reduced performance. |

Circuit Description
The electronic control module (ECM) uses the gas mass flow sensor to measure fuel into the engine and to adjust the fuel control valve based on this measurement.
Component Location
The gas mass flow sensor is located on the fuel housing.
Shop Talk
Make sure that the screen located in the fuel housing is free from debris and oil.
The voltage supply for the C series engine must be maintained at or above 13.5 VDC for proper sensor operation. On the B series engine the voltage must be maintained above 12 VDC for proper sensor operation. This can be monitored in the INSITE™ electronic service tool with parameter sensor supply 3.

Troubleshooting Steps
| STEPS | SPECIFICATIONS | |
|---|---|---|
| STEP 1. | Check the fault codes. | |
| STEP 1A. Read the fault codes. | Fault Code 453 active? | |
| STEP 2. | Check the sensor. | |
| STEP 2A. Inspect the engine harness and gas mass flow sensor connector pins. | Dirty or damaged pins? | |
| STEP 2B. Check for circuit response. | Fault Code 454 active and Fault Code 453 inactive? | |
| STEP 2C. Check the sensor supply voltage and return circuit. | Voltage to specifications? | |
| STEP 2D. Read the fault codes. | Fault Code 453 active? | |
| STEP 3. | Check the engine harness. | |
| STEP 3A. Inspect the engine harness, OEM harness, and ECM connector pins. | Dirty or damaged pins? | |
| STEP 3B. Check for an open circuit in the engine harness. | Less than 10 ohms? | |
| STEP 3C. Check for a pin to pin short circuit in the engine harness. | Greater than 100k ohms? | |
| STEP 3C-1. Check for a pin to pin short circuit in the engine harness. | ||
| STEP 3D. Read the fault codes. | Fault Code 453 active? | |
| STEP 4. | Clear the fault codes. | |
| STEP 4A. Disable the fault code. | Fault Code 453 inactive? | |
| STEP 4B. Clear the inactive fault codes. | All fault codes cleared? | |
